> >>    This was a frequency that many years ago was called DC 
> >> Notification or something close. Used by buffs to learn of fire 
> >> incidents and and report from the location of same. Vito was either 
> >> the owner or a large part of it. It was still active in the 80's 
> >> but I don't know if still active. You are right the same frequency 
> >> was also used with a different PL.
> >> The only NECW I am aware of is New England Citywide at this link 
> >> http://newenglandcitywide.com/meminfo.html  This radio buff group 
> >> is affiliated with 1RWN if you are aware of that group which is 
> >> part of 1st responder News. NECW I believe was started by members 
> >> of the long time Hartford Citywide radio system that at one time 
> >> had repeaters in many parts of CT.

> >>> Today I was playing around with my Home Patrol and had it scan the
> local
> >>> media frequencies. It stopped on a channel with a bank name of 
> >>> "Firebuffs,"
> >>> and a channel name of "Citywide Radio Ch. 1 Primary," which had 
> >>> some
> guy
> >>> reporting a fire somewhere (I did not catch it, and it was not 
> >>> repeated).
> >>> It
> >>> was not a dispatch, but sounded literally like a fire buff 
> >>> reporting a working fire. The channel is a conventional analog 
> >>> channel with a frequency of 452.975 MHz. There is also a citywide 
> >>> secondary channel for
> Firebuffs
> >>> programmed into the HP, but it's the same frequency as the 
> >>> primary, so
> I
> >>> don't know why it's in there (maybe a different tone?).
> >>>
> >>> Anybody have any more info about this frequency and/or any 
> >>> information about who the "Firebuffs" are?
